    Yes it's high. Half of those that worked at the company the day before I was hired have left in 4 years. Many addional people hired after me have come an gone in 4 years as well. Which means the turn over rate is higher than 50% in 4 years. A well education approximation would be at least 15%per year. How do I know? The company used to give out mission patches of every launch with your seniority number on them which would decrease every launch as people who were more senior than you left. Of course budget cuts over the last 6 months took away this "perk".

    Will match TC from a lot of places, but with mostly paper stock. Competitive compared to most of Los Angeles, but not the bay area. Turnover isn't that bad, but people tend to drop off when their initial stock offer fully vests
